Liz Lemon, (Tina Fey) is the head writer on a variety series on NBC Studios. With the Jack Donaghy as Vice President of East Coast Television, played by Alec Baldwin, Series four sustains the same standard that has maintained it so far with plenty of exceptional moments. The characters are still all hugely dysfunctional and written with enormous affection and comic effect. The situations beautifully constructed. This set contains all the episodes from the show’s fourth series.

BABE (1995)

CertificationU Our Rating

A cute porker living under the curious notion that it's a sheep dog, and eventually having to prove it. A delightful tale of rural life on the farm down under, charming, witty gentle and with almost blemishless animatronics. It truly manages to entertain child and adult alike. A fantastic family movie and one of the best pure adventure films ever made. THE film that single-handedly made archaeologists hip, as Ford battles to save the Biblical Ark of the Covenant from the dastardly Nazis. JUMANJI (1995)

CertificationPG Our Rating

Wild-eyed Williams plays Alan Parrish, set free by orphans Judy and Peter after 26 years trapped inside a magical jungle boardgame. A musical comedy about a blood-thirsty plant (voice, care of Levi Stubbs) from Outerspace seems a touch unlikely, but this is just what this movie is! Finding the plant, Audrey, shoots shop assistant Rick Moranis to fame and fortune - but the answer to his problems soon starts to create more of them. Good family fun!
